If I were a Royalsâ fan, Iâd hate the Guardians.
There was all the reason in the world to think the Royals would win this series today. Seth Lugo had the best numbers of any pitcher on Kansas Cityâs roster so far this year, and Slade Cecconi has been the worst pitcher on the Guardiansâ roster. Lugo has also mostly owned the Guardians. But, thatâs why they play the games, folks. Somehow, the Guardians won today and have a 4-3 lead on the Royals in their season series, needing to win only three more games to clinch the season series (which could be significant).

But, it turns out, the Guardians are capable of hitting Seth Lugo.
Then finally got one off the Kansas City pen:
Kwan had a hit and a walk, DeLauter had a hit and a walk, Jose had a hit and 2 walks, had a huge double and almost hit another one out, Schneemann had a hit and a walk, Bazzana had a hit and a walk, Rocchio had two hits and a walk, Naylor had two hits and Halpin had a hit and a walk. See, now, Guardians? Wasnât that easy? Do that every night.
Slade Cecconi was better! Still gave up six hits and three walks and should be lifted after five. But, he bought himself more time, especially since isnât doing much. is bad and needs to be replaced by Franco Aleman, struggled AGAIN and had to be rescued by overpowering . And looks back to his old self, thank heavens, striking out two.
Oh, also, Travis Bazzana made a heads up play and a great throw to nail trying to go to third:
